摘要
Carbon nanotubes (CNTs) were employed for the removal of toxic hexavalent chromium ions (Cr6+) from aqueous solution. The adsorption capacity of Cr6+ on CNTs increased with an increase in the concentration of Cr6+, and then reach a plateau between 300-700 mg/L of Cr6+; and the capacity was also significantly affected by the pH value of the solution between 2 and 7, and little change was observed above pH value of 7. By comparison, CNTs showed higher adsorption capacity of Cr6+ than the commercial activated carbon under the same experimental conditions.
